A Site Reliability Engineer is a specialized software engineer focused on creating scalable and highly reliable software systems. The core philosophy of the role is to treat operational challenges as software problems, applying engineering principles to automate solutions, improve system resilience, and streamline processes. Professionals in this field are responsible for the entire lifecycle of a service, from design and deployment to monitoring and incident response, ensuring that systems are not only functional but also efficient and robust under real-world conditions. Typical responsibilities for a Site Reliability Engineer are multifaceted. A primary duty is defining and upholding Service Level Objectives (SLOs) and Service Level Indicators (SLIs) to quantitatively measure a system's reliability and performance. This involves extensive work in observability, implementing comprehensive logging, metrics, and tracing to gain deep insights into system behavior. SREs actively work to eliminate manual, repetitive work (often called "toil") through automation, using infrastructure as code (IaC) tools to manage provisioning and configuration. They architect and build internal platforms and tooling that enable consistent deployments and efficient operations. Crucially, SREs are on the front lines of incident management, owning production issues from detection through to resolution and conducting blameless post-mortems to prevent future occurrences. The skill set required for Site Reliability Engineer jobs is a powerful blend of software engineering and systems expertise. Proficiency in programming languages like Python, Go, or Java is essential for automation and tool development. A deep understanding of operating systems, networking, and cloud platforms (such as AWS, GCP, or Azure) forms the foundation. Experience with containerization and orchestration technologies like Docker and Kubernetes is now standard, as is familiarity with CI/CD pipelines and IaC tools like Terraform or Ansible. Beyond technical prowess, successful SREs possess strong problem-solving skills, a proactive mindset focused on prevention, and excellent collaboration abilities to work closely with development and product teams. They are driven by a passion for building systems that are scalable, secure, and resilient.
